SAP ABAP Interface IF_SWF_WFM_COMPONENT_WIM (WFM: Process Component)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-BMT-WFM (Application Component) SAP Business Workflow
     SWP (Package) Business Workflow: Processor
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_SWF_WFM_COMPOSITE_WIM WFM: Structured Process Component with WIM Handle 20030623
2 Interface implementation (CLASS c. INTERFACES i_ref)  CL_SWF_WFM_LEAF_WIM 20030620
Properties
Interface IF_SWF_WFM_COMPONENT_WIM  
Short Description WFM: Process Component    
General Data
Package SWP   Business Workflow: Processor 
Created 20030305   SAP 
Last changed 20110908   SAP 
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 SWFCO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
# Interface Abstract Final Description Created on
1 IF_SWF_WFM_WIM_REQUEST WFM: Interface for WIM 20030620
Friends
Interface IF_SWF_WFM_COMPONENT_WIM has no friend.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 M_DISCARD_AT_CLEANUP Instance attribute Public Type reference (TYPE) FLAG 20031120
2 M_RESTART_ACTIVE Instance attribute Public Type reference (TYPE) FLAG 20051108
3 M_TASK_HANDLE Instance attribute Public Object reference (TYPE REF TO) IF_SWF_RUN_TASK_ATTRIBUTES 20030620
4 M_WFDKEY Instance attribute Public Type reference (TYPE) SWD_WFDKEY 20030924
5 M_WIM_HANDLE Instance attribute Public Object reference (TYPE REF TO) IF_SWF_RUN_WIM_WFM 20030620
Methods
# Method Level Visibility Method type Description Created on
1 COMPLETE_VIA_LOCAL_EVENT Instance method Public Method Cancels wait steps waiting for local events 20031113
2 GET_PARFOREACH_INDEX Instance method Public Method 20030701
3 GET_RESULT Instance method Public Method Gets result of work item execution 20030818
4 GET_TASK_HANDLE Instance method Public Method Gets task handle (if available) 20030620
5 GET_WIID Instance method Public Method Delivers the Work Item ID 20031026
6 GET_WI_HIERARCHY Instance method Public Method 20030822
7 SET_ERROR_TO_LOG Instance method Public Method Writes error to log list 20031111
8 SET_OBSOLETE Instance method Public Method Sets work item to obsolete 20030925
Events
Interface IF_SWF_WFM_COMPONENT_WIM has no event.
Types
Interface IF_SWF_WFM_COMPONENT_WIM has no local type.
Method Signatures

Method COMPLETE_VIA_LOCAL_EVENT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_LOCAL_EVENT_CONTAINER Call by reference Object reference (TYPE REF TO) IF_SWF_CNT_CONTAINER Container - Implementierung einer 'Collection' 20031113
2 Importing IM_LOCAL_EVENT_NAME Call by reference Type reference (TYPE) SWD_LEVTNAM Name eines lokalen Ereignisses 20041022

Method COMPLETE_VIA_LOCAL_EVENT on Interface IF_SWF_WFM_COMPONENT_WIM has no exception.

Method GET_PARFOREACH_INDEX Signature

Method GET_PARFOREACH_INDEX on Interface IF_SWF_WFM_COMPONENT_WIM has no parameter.
Method GET_PARFOREACH_INDEX on Interface IF_SWF_WFM_COMPONENT_WIM has no exception.

Method GET_RESULT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RE_RESULT Value transfer Object reference (TYPE REF TO) IF_SWF_RUN_RESULT 20030818
# Exception Resumable Description Created on
1 CX_SWF_WFM_EMPTY_RESULT WFM: Methode liefert kein Ergebnis 20031011

Method GET_TASK_HANDLE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RE_TASK_HANDLE Value transfer Object reference (TYPE REF TO) IF_SWF_RUN_TASK_ATTRIBUTES 20030620
# Exception Resumable Description Created on
1 CX_SWF_WFM WFM: Ausnahme 20040206
2 CX_SWF_WFM_METHOD_ABSURD WFM: Methodenaufruf an konkreter Instanz unsinnig 20031011

Method GET_WIID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ning RE_WIID Value transfer Type reference (TYPE) SWW_WIID 20031026

Method GET_WIID on Interface IF_SWF_WFM_COMPONENT_WIM has no exception.

Method GET_WI_HIERARCHY Signature

Method GET_WI_HIERARCHY on Interface IF_SWF_WFM_COMPONENT_WIM has no parameter.
Method GET_WI_HIERARCHY on Interface IF_SWF_WFM_COMPONENT_WIM has no exception.

Method SET_ERROR_TO_LOG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IM_EXCEPTION Call by reference Object reference (TYPE REF TO) CX_SWF_WFM WFM: Ausnahme 20031111
2 Importing IM_FUNCNAME Call by reference Type reference (TYPE) SWF_METNAM Workflow: Methodenname 20031111

Method SET_ERROR_TO_LOG on Interface IF_SWF_WFM_COMPONENT_WIM has no exception.

Method SET_OBSOLETE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ing CH_FAILURE_COUNTER Value transfer Type reference (TYPE) SYINDEX Schleifenindex 20050517
2 Importing IM_RETRY_MODE Value transfer Type reference (TYPE) FLAG SPACE allgemeines flag 20050517

Method SET_OBSOLETE on Interface IF_SWF_WFM_COMPONENT_WIM has no exception.
History
Last changed by/on SAP  20110908 
SAP Release Created in 640